- 浏览: 146148 次
- 性别:
- 来自: 杭州
最新评论
-
cha_bill:
new Long 空间换时间Long.valueOf 时间换空 ...
请慎用new Integer()、new Long()…… -
何飞同学要加油:
文件系统不一样好像是说 windows和Linux的文件默认为 ...
请慎用java的File#renameTo(File)方法 -
lvxiaoxi:
还有一种情况,看我的博文:http://lvxiaoxi.it ...
请慎用java的File#renameTo(File)方法 -
kililanxilu:
weiqingfei 写道1、慎用 Integer Long ...
请慎用new Integer()、new Long()…… -
di1984HIT:
人家Integer源代码里面小的数字都缓存了。
请慎用new Integer()、new Long()……
相关推荐
在Oracle数据库中,进行大批量数据删除是一项需要注意性能和安全性的任务。常见的方法包括使用DELETE语句、FOR ALL语句,以及通过存储过程实现分批删除。以下将详细阐述这些方法及其优缺点。 首先,最基本的删除...
4. 利用事务控制:在大批量数据插入、更新或删除时,合理使用事务,可以减少磁盘I/O,提升处理速度。但也要注意事务不能过大,以免造成锁竞争和日志空间的过度消耗。 除了SQL层面的优化外,数据库管理系统还提供了...
Oracle中大批量删除数据的方法 Oracle中大批量删除数据的...使用 PL/SQL procedure 实现大批量删除数据是一个非常高效的方法,但需要根据实际情况灵活地调整删除的记录数和条件,以确保删除操作的高效性和可靠性。
综上所述,这个Oracle环境下的数据删除小程序是一个综合性的解决方案,旨在安全、高效地执行大规模数据清理。它结合了条件筛选、分批处理、事务控制、日志记录和用户交互等多个方面,为数据库管理员提供了一种可靠的...
传统的数据处理方式,例如直接使用参数化SQL或DataSet与DataAdapter,可能会在处理大批量数据时遇到性能瓶颈,因为每次操作都要对目标表进行多次独立的SQL交互。这种情况下,数据库的优化效果可能无法满足需求,尤其...
在构建和管理Oracle数据仓库的过程中,对大批量数据的处理是一项关键任务。为了高效地处理大量数据,了解和掌握特定的技术至关重要。以下是一些核心知识点的详细解释: 1. **分区技术**:Oracle数据库提供了一种...
当服务器积累了大量文件,特别是需要大批量删除时,手动操作不仅耗时,而且效率低下,尤其是在处理大型文件夹时,可能会遇到因资源占用过多而无法正常打开的情况。这时,利用特定的工具进行自动化删除就显得尤为重要...
oracle大批量处理数
1. **性能提升**:通过只访问所需的数据分区,查询和DML(插入、更新和删除)操作的速度显著加快。对于涉及大量数据的事务,分区可以极大地减少I/O操作。 2. **可管理性**:历史数据的清理变得更加容易,因为可以...
Oracle的分区技术是一种高效的数据管理策略,特别是在处理大数据量时,能够显著提升数据库的性能、可管理和可用性。分区的基本思想是将一个大的数据对象(如表或索引)分割成若干个小的物理段,根据分区字段的值将...
这是因为`DELETE`语句不仅会删除数据,还会记录这些操作的日志,这在大数据量的情况下会消耗大量的时间和资源。为了解决这个问题,文中提到了两种高效的方法。 第一种方法是利用`IMPORT`命令配合一个空文件来清空表...
此外,对于大批量的数据删除,考虑到性能问题,可以考虑使用`TRUNCATE TABLE`命令。相比于`DELETE`,`TRUNCATE`不记录单个行的删除,而是移除表中的所有数据并重置表的自动增长列。但请注意,`TRUNCATE`不能与`WHERE...
Qt5开发及实例,实例CH1301,基于控制台的程序,使用SQLite数据库完成大批量数据的增加、删除、更新和查询操作并输出。 实现步骤如下。 (1)在“QSQLiteEx.pro”文件中添加如下代码: QT += sql (2)源文件“main....
- **分批删除**:如果数据量过大,可以将删除操作分成多个批次,每次处理一部分数据,以减轻日志压力和系统资源消耗。 - **索引调整**:确保删除操作涉及的列上有合适的索引,可以显著提高查询速度。但是,删除操作...